[regexp] Hide the generic JSRegExp::DataAt/SetDataAt accessors

.. and refactor js-regexp.h.

- Hide the generic DataAt/SetDataAt accessors and replace them by
  dedicated accessors. Use the common lower_case naming scheme for
  these.
- Shuffle around definitions in js-regexp.h s.t. they are in a
  meaningful order.
- Dedupe the source/flags accessors - these fields are stored both
  on the instance and on the data array. We keep only accessors for
  the instance. Previously, these were disambiguated through naming
  oddities (e.g. Pattern() returned data->source).
